Abstract
The disclosure is directed to a kind of electronic equipment, including:Integral housing, the integral housing include backboard, extend the wall formed along perpendicular to the direction of the backboard by the edge of the backboard, and the wall surrounds the receiving space for accommodating electronic component in the electronic equipment with the backboard;Screen module, the screen module are matched with the opening that the wall surrounds and assembled with the integral housing and fixed, and viewing area corresponding to the screen module is paved with the corresponding surface on the electronic equipment.Electronic equipment in the disclosure is obtained by screen module and the assembling fixation of the housing of integral type, reduces the quantity of electronic equipment outward appearance detachable part, be advantageous to electronic equipment is assemblied in dismounting;Also, the utilization rate of receiving space can be improved using integral housing, and be advantageous to improve the water proofing property of electronic equipment.

Fig. 1 is the decomposing schematic representation of a kind of electronic equipment according to an exemplary embodiment, as shown in figure 1, the electricity
Sub- equipment 100 includes integral housing 1 and screen module 2, wherein, the integral housing 1 can be by plastics and/or metal (gold
Category alloy) etc. material be made.For example, the integral housing 1 can have plastics and metal to pass through NMT (Nano Molding
Technology, nanometer injection)) technique is integrally formed, and can also pass through CNC machine-shapings on the integral housing 1
The fastening structure being adapted to the internal electronic element of electronic equipment 100;Viewing area corresponding to screen module 2 is paved with the electronics and set
Standby 100 corresponding surface, i.e. the screen module 2 can use screen structure comprehensively, to improve the screen accounting of electronic equipment 100.This
Disclosed electronic equipment 100 can include mobile phone, tablet device, electronic reader etc., and the disclosure is limited not to this.
In the present embodiment, integral housing 1 can include backboard 11 and by backboard 11 edge along perpendicular to backboard
11 direction extends the wall 12 to be formed, and the wall 12 can surround with backboard 11 accommodates electronic component appearance in electronic equipment 100
Receive space 13;Further, screen module 2 can coordinate along the opposite direction of the bearing of trend of wall 12 and be opened with what wall 13 surrounded
Mouth simultaneously assembles fixation with integral housing 1, to obtain electronic equipment 100, reduces the number of the outward appearance detachable part of electronic equipment 100
Amount, be advantageous to the utilization rate for being assemblied in dismounting, receiving space 13 being improved using integral housing 1 of electronic equipment 100, and
Be advantageous to improve the water proofing property of electronic equipment.
Further, as shown in Figure 2 and Figure 3, the top edge portion of the wall 12 of integral housing 1 and screen module 2
Corresponding edge part coordinates, and the contact position of integral housing 1 and screen module 2 can be caused to carry out arc-shaped transition, with lifting
The gripping feel and aesthetics of electronic equipment 100.
In one embodiment, the electronic equipment 100 can also include adhesive linkage 3 as shown in Figure 2, and the adhesive linkage 3 is positioned at screen
Between the curtain side wall of module 2 and the corresponding inwall of receiving space 13, then, it can lead between screen module 2 and integral housing 1
Cross the adhesive linkage 3 and carry out assembling fixation.Wherein, the adhesive linkage 3 can be side and the receiving space 13 for being applied to screen module 2
Corresponding inwall between glue curing form, and using solidified glue would generally have buffering characteristic, in electronic equipment
100 when dropping or being collided, and the adhesive linkage 3 can provide buffering, reduces the probability of damage of screen module 2.The glue can
Think marine glue, to improve the water resistance of electronic equipment 100, the glue can also be light-sensitive emulsion, and certainly, the glue can also
It can solidify including other and the glue of stable form is presented after hardening, the disclosure is limited not to this.
In another embodiment, luggage can also be entered by way of clamping between the integral housing 1 and screen module 2
With fixation.For example, electronic equipment 100 can also include the buckle 4 for being adhered to screen module 2 as shown in Figure 4, and in one
The button bit 14 being adapted with the buckle 4 on the inwall of receiving space 13 can be included on sandwich type element 1, by the button bit 14 with
The cooperation of buckle 4 can realize that the assembling between integral housing 1 and screen module 2 is fixed.Wherein, the buckle 4 can be such as Fig. 4
The shown bottom surface for being adhered to screen module 2, it can also be adhered to the side wall of screen module 2 as shown in Figure 5, with electronic equipment
100 drop or buffering are provided when being collided, and reduce the probability of damage of screen module 2.
Further, for the gap reduced between screen module 2 and integral housing 1 as much as possible, electronics is lifted
The aesthetic property and water proofing property of equipment 100, can by the width in all directions of screen module 2 it is corresponding with receiving space 13 on width
The cooperation gap of degree is controlled in allowed band, then, the buckle 4 in above-described embodiment can be made of elastomeric material, with
When assembling screen module 2, the buckle 4 can deform upon and recover deformation when coordinating with button bit 14, realize screen module 2
Assembling fix;Analogously, when dismantling screen module 2, the buckle 4 can also deform upon, and be separated in screen module 2
Recover deformation when integral housing 1.Wherein, the buckle 4 can be made up of sheet metal, and the disclosure is limited not to this
System,
In above-mentioned each embodiment, the buckle 4 can include guiding face 41, and the guiding face 41 is close to electronic equipment
100 viewing area is set, and to be guided in assembly or disassembly screen module 2, is advantageous to integral housing 1 and screen mould
Separation and assembling between group 2.
Technical scheme based on the disclosure, screen module 2 can include single display screen as shown in Figure 1, and the list
Viewing area corresponding to individual display screen is paved with the corresponding surface of electronic equipment 100;Or as shown in fig. 6, the screen module 2 can be with
Including the first display screen 21 and second display screen 22, viewing area corresponding to first display screen 21 and the correspondence of second display screen 22
Viewing area can be paved with the corresponding surface of electronic equipment 100 so that can be used for the display of display on electronic equipment 100
Region is 1 or close to 1 with the area ratio on corresponding surface, reaches the effect shown comprehensively.Certainly, in other embodiments,
Screen module 2 can also include greater number of display screen, and the disclosure is limited not to this.
Wherein, when viewing area corresponding to viewing area corresponding to the first display screen 21 and second display screen 22 can be paved with
During the corresponding surface of electronic equipment 100, the first display screen 21, the specification of second display screen 22 and position there may be a variety of feelings
Condition, the disclosure are limited not to this.For example, second display screen 2 can be located at the fringe region of electronic equipment 100,
And the first display screen 21 is paved with other regions on electronic equipment 100;Such as in the embodiment shown in fig. 6, second display screen
Can be with 22 bottom edge regions for being located at electronic equipment 100, for another example in the embodiment shown in fig. 7, second display screen 22 can
With positioned at the side edge region of electronic equipment 100.
When screen module 2 includes multiple display screens, it is possible to achieve a variety of display scenes.With the first above-mentioned display screen 21
Exemplified by second display screen 22:In one case, the first display screen 21 can be taken as one piece completely with second display screen 22
Display screen, for realizing the full frame displaying of same content;In another case, the first display screen 21 and second display screen
22 can be separately applied to the different content that displaying is engaged, for example the first display screen 21 can be as electronic equipment 100
Primary display screen, second display screen 22 can be as the secondary display screens of electronic equipment 100, for example in the embodiment shown in Fig. 8
In, the first display screen 21 is used to show that standby interface, second display screen 22 are used to show contents such as missed call etc..
When screen module 2 includes multiple display screens, can by controlling the switches of multiple display screens, realize power consumption with
The balance of convenience.For example in the standby state, it is less that the first larger display screen 21 of area, only Retention area can be closed
Second display screen 22, and the content such as displaying time, missed call, unread message in second display screen 22 so that can both incite somebody to action
The lower power consumption of screen module 2 to acceptable scope, and can enough facilitates user to check time and missed call, unread message
Deng.
